Unit 6: DESCRIBE AN APARTMENT

UNIT 6.1: WELCOME TO MY NEW APARTMENT

 

Cheryl: Hi!

Mom: Hi!

Cheryl: Welcome to my new apartment, Mom!

Mom: I liked your old apartment at 24 OAK Street better

Cheryl: That’s because you live at 22 OAK Street.

Mom: Your old apartment has such a nice view

Cheryl: The view here is nice too, Mom.

The park is just across the street, and my office is around the corner.

Mom: Nice refrigerator.

          It’s very small, isn’t it?

Cheryl: The refrigerator?

Mom: The kitchen.

Cheryl: It’s a little small. But I like it.

          There’s the dining room…

          The office…

          And… The living room

Mom: The chairs are nice

            I like the Sofa

             Why’s the dresser in the living room?

Cheryl: There’s no place else for it to go

Mom : But where are the other rooms, honey?

Cheryl: Mom, it’s a studio apartment. There are no other rooms.

Mom: This is it?

Cheryl: This is it!

Mom: But, where is the bedroom?

Cheryl: Ta da

Mom: I’m afraid to ask about the bathroom.

Cheryl: Oh, mom.

I think it’s nice.

UNIT 6.2: DO YOU LIVE IN A HOUSE OR IN AN APARTMENT?

PV: Do you live in a house or an apartment?

Rob: I live in an apartment.

Chris: I live in the house.

Christiane: I live in an apartment.

PV: And do you have a large living room?

Catherine: I would say medium sized.

PV: And what sorts of furniture do you have in your living room?

Rob: We have a sofa and a lounge chair and a coffee table and a television set.

PV: Does your apartment have a lot of windows?

Emma: Actually in every room there is a window.

PV: Does your apartment have a balcony?

Christiane: No, my apartment does not have a balcony.

PV: How about a garden?

Catherine: We do have a backyard.

PV: What appliances are there in your kitchen?

Chris: We’ve got a cooker a microwave. We’ve got a fridge and freezer, but in fact we’ve got everything apart from a dishwasher.

PV: And the cooker. What’s a cooker?

Chris: A stove.

PV: Do you like your apartment?

Rob: I love my apartment.

Christiane: Yes, i like my apartment a lot.

PV: And why?

Christiane: Because I painted it in my colors and it’s my home, it’s my little castle
